In-depth Look: Manufacturing Processes and Quality Assurance for pan belly
Manufacturing Processes for Pan Belly
The manufacturing of pan belly, a crucial component in various industrial applications, involves several meticulously orchestrated stages to ensure high-quality output. Understanding these processes is vital for international B2B buyers looking to source pan belly components from reliable suppliers.
Material Preparation
The first step in the manufacturing process is material preparation. Typically, pan belly is made from high-quality metals such as stainless steel or aluminum, chosen for their durability and resistance to corrosion.
- Material Selection: Ensure that the chosen material aligns with the intended application and industry standards. For instance, food-grade stainless steel is essential for culinary applications.
- Cutting and Shaping: Raw materials are cut into specified dimensions using advanced cutting techniques such as laser cutting or plasma cutting. Precision in this stage affects subsequent processes and the final product’s integrity.
Forming
Once the materials are prepared, the next phase is forming. This stage involves shaping the cut materials into the desired profile of the pan belly.
- Techniques: Common techniques include stamping, bending, and deep drawing. Stamping is often used for producing flat shapes, while deep drawing is suitable for creating more complex, three-dimensional forms.
- Tooling: The use of specialized dies and molds is critical in achieving the required shapes with high accuracy. Investing in high-quality tooling can lead to reduced waste and improved efficiency.
Assembly
The assembly process integrates various components into a single unit. In the context of pan belly, this may involve welding or fastening different pieces together.
- Welding Techniques: Methods such as TIG (Tungsten Inert Gas) or MIG (Metal Inert Gas) welding are commonly employed. The choice of welding technique depends on the material and the required strength of the joints.
- Quality of Joints: Inspecting welds for defects is essential to ensure structural integrity. Using non-destructive testing methods like ultrasonic testing can help verify the quality of welds without damaging the components.
Finishing
Finishing is the final stage in the manufacturing process, aimed at enhancing the product’s appearance and performance.
- Surface Treatment: Techniques such as polishing, anodizing, or powder coating may be applied. These treatments improve aesthetics, resistance to corrosion, and ease of cleaning.
- Final Inspection: Before packaging, a thorough inspection is conducted to ensure that the pan belly meets all specifications and quality standards.

Quality Control Checkpoints
Quality control (QC) checkpoints are crucial in monitoring quality at various stages of the manufacturing process.
- Incoming Quality Control (IQC): This initial inspection ensures that raw materials meet specified standards before they enter the production line. A robust IQC process minimizes defects at later stages.
- In-Process Quality Control (IPQC): During manufacturing, IPQC monitors processes to identify and rectify issues in real-time. This proactive approach helps in maintaining quality throughout production.
- Final Quality Control (FQC): The final inspection verifies that the completed product meets all specifications and standards before shipping.
Common Testing Methods
Various testing methods are employed to ensure the quality and safety of pan belly products:
- Mechanical Testing: Tests such as tensile strength and hardness assessments evaluate the material’s performance characteristics.
- Non-Destructive Testing (NDT): Techniques like ultrasonic and radiographic testing help identify internal defects without compromising the product.
- Dimensional Inspection: Using tools like calipers and micrometers, manufacturers verify that dimensions are within specified tolerances.

Common Trade Terminology
-
OEM (Original Equipment Manufacturer)
– An OEM is a company that produces parts or equipment that may be marketed by another manufacturer. Understanding OEM relationships can help buyers identify quality manufacturers and ensure compatibility with existing systems. -
MOQ (Minimum Order Quantity)
– MOQ refers to the minimum number of units that a supplier is willing to sell in a single order. For international buyers, knowing the MOQ is vital for managing inventory and ensuring cost-effectiveness, especially when entering new markets. -
RFQ (Request for Quotation)
– An RFQ is a document sent to suppliers to request pricing and other terms for specific products. This is a critical step in the procurement process as it allows buyers to compare offers and make informed purchasing decisions. -
Incoterms (International Commercial Terms)
– Incoterms are a series of pre-defined commercial terms published by the International Chamber of Commerce (ICC) that clarify the responsibilities of buyers and sellers in international trade. Familiarity with these terms is essential for managing risks and understanding shipping logistics. -
Lead Time
– Lead time is the period between placing an order and receiving the goods. It is crucial for planning production schedules and inventory levels. Understanding lead times can help buyers mitigate risks associated with supply chain disruptions. -
Sourcing Strategy
– A sourcing strategy outlines the approach to obtaining goods and services, including selecting suppliers and negotiating terms. Having a clear sourcing strategy is vital for maximizing value and ensuring long-term supplier relationships.
